Investment Banker Salary in the UK

Investment bankers advise companies on mergers, acquisitions, and capital raising. They structure deals, conduct due diligence, and manage client relationships.

Investment Banker Take Home Pay

On the average Investment Banker salary of £85,000, you would take home £59,857 per year (£4,988.12 per month) after tax and National Insurance.

Investment Banker Salary FAQ

What is the average Investment Banker salary in the UK?

The average Investment Banker salary in the UK is £85,000 per year. Salaries typically range from £50,000 for entry-level positions to £200,000 for senior roles.

How much does a Investment Banker earn in London?

A Investment Banker in London earns an average of £95,000 per year, which is 46% higher than the national average.

What is the take-home pay for a Investment Banker?

On the average Investment Banker salary of £85,000, you would take home approximately £59,857 per year (£4,988.12 per month) after income tax and National Insurance.
